The bill, H.B. No. 1597, mandates the development of a training program for county jailers focused on interactions with veterans in the criminal justice system. This program will be created by the commission in consultation with the Texas Veterans Commission and will be added as Section 1701.273 to the Occupations Code. Additionally, the existing requirements for county jailer training will be amended to include this new program as part of the preparatory training that must be completed before appointment.
Furthermore, the bill stipulates that all county jailers, regardless of when their licenses were issued, must complete the new training program by August 31, 2027. The law will take effect on September 1, 2025. The amendments also specify that the preparatory training program must consist of at least eight hours of mental health training approved by the relevant commissions, ensuring that county jailers are adequately prepared to support veterans in their care.
